Flastacowo, 1938, page 17. Image of Gilchrist Hall with text: "Gilchrist, newest of the dormitories and home of upper classmen. Surrounded on one side by the smoking area and the other by Broward and facing the Sweet Shop, hang out of the students."

Florida Flambeau XXXIII, no. 18. Fire alarm was accidentally pulled during a routine check at Gilchrist Hall. The local fire department alarm was sounded rather than the campus alarm

Florida Flambeau XXXVI, no. 19. Newspaper created to discuss news from each of the five floors of Gilchrist Hall, Frances Cawthon elected as editor. First issue was to be Thursday, December 14.

Hartwell first arrived at FSU in 1941, and recalls the curfews and lights out calls at Gilchrist in an interview with Kenneth S. Brown
